Bradford Children's Trust is seeking a skilled and dedicated Practice Supervisor to join our Duty and Assessment Team. This pivotal role involves leading and supporting a team of social workers to deliver high-quality assessments and safeguarding services to children and families in the Bradford area.

Key Responsibilities:

Leadership and Supervision: Provide leadership and supervision to a team of social workers, ensuring they receive the guidance and support needed to carry out their duties effectively.
Quality Assurance: Oversee the quality of assessments and interventions, ensuring they meet statutory requirements and best practice standards.
Case Management: Assist in the management of complex cases, providing expert advice and decision-making support.
Safeguarding: Ensure the safeguarding of children and young people is prioritized, adhering to all relevant legislation and protocols.
Training and Development: Identify training needs within the team and facilitate ongoing professional development opportunities.
Performance Monitoring: Monitor team performance, providing feedback and implementing improvement plans as necessary.
Collaboration: Work collaboratively with other agencies and professionals to ensure comprehensive and effective service delivery.Requirements:

Qualified Social Worker: Must be a registered Social Worker with a recognized qualification.
Experience: Substantial experience in children's social work, particularly in duty and assessment settings.
Supervisory Skills: Proven experience in supervising and leading a team of social workers.
Knowledge: Strong understanding of child protection, safeguarding, and relevant legislation.
Communication Skills: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to build positive relationships with team members and external partners.
